CPU-Z: CPU-Z is a widely-used system information utility for Windows and Android platforms. Developed by CPUID, the tool provides detailed information about the hardware components of a computer or mobile device. It offers insights into the CPU, memory, motherboard, and other system details, aiding users in hardware monitoring and diagnostics.

Derive: Derive is a mathematical software program used for symbolic and numeric manipulation of mathematical expressions. It has a graphical user interface and can perform various calculations, plot graphs, solve equations, and assist with math education.

CPU-Z Features
  • Provides detailed CPU information like name, codename, process, socket, frequency, instructions
  • Shows RAM timings, frequency, size and channel configuration
  • Displays motherboard details like model, chipset, BIOS version
  • Reports graphics card details like GPU, memory, drivers
  • Monitors core voltages, temperatures and fan speeds
  • Can validate overclock settings and benchmark performance
  • Lightweight app with minimal impact on system resources
  • Available for Windows and Android platforms
